Boarding Patrol: Adeptus Custodes Three new Warhammer 40k Boarding Patrol boxes have been revealed, this time for Adepta Sororitas, Adeptus Custodes, and Thousand Sons! This set comes with 22 multipart plastic miniatures, including a pair of Aspiring Sorcerers leading a group of Rubric Marines armed with enchanted bolters and mutagenic warpflamers. This set comprises 100 plastic components, and is supplied with 4x Citadel 60x35mm Oval Bases. These miniatures are supplied unpainted and require assembly – we recommend using Citadel Plastic Glue and Citadel Colour paints.
